If the pipeline's service account is disabled, crash symbolication halts and mobile reports queue in the intake bucket. First, confirm the outage in the pipeline dashboard, then file a recovery request with the Platform Desk and note the backlog depth. Once the account is restored, drain the queue oldest-first; symbolication catches up at roughly 2k reports per minute. The restoration console requires two-person approval plus a passphrase. When the console prompts you, enter the passphrase shown below.

strongbox words: belath-holwyn-quenir-pelmir-istix-quenius-quenix-pramir-pelax-belax

Subject: Broker upgrade — action needed from plugin authors

Hello all,

We are upgrading the Hollowpine message broker from the 3.x line to 5.1 during the next maintenance window. Plugins compiled against the legacy wire protocol will fail handshake after the cutover. Please rebuild against the new client library and run the published compatibility suite before resubmitting. Legacy acknowledgement modes are removed; use the durable-confirm API instead. Target your builds at the release identified below.

trace token, bagag-fahag: htk21_1a5003b533f7b0cca4331

Changed defaults in Splitfork, our assignment service. Bucketing now uses sticky hashing per account instead of per session, and the holdout slice grew from 2% to 5%. Callers relying on session-level reassignment must opt in explicitly. Review the diff against the new baseline; the updated default configuration is listed below.

config for tagep-kajof:
[casir]
port = 6379
region = south-1
host = casir.paliqdyn.example
team = tamax
timeout_ms = 250
retries = 2